Sandy’s recent passing created a greater sense of community by island residents, and both year-round and summer residents have been coming together to volunteer and give donations.
In this spirit of community giving, resident Margie Goodman initiated a campaign to stage a free Thanksgiving dinner for all Brigantine residents, and she has been supported through a social network of friends and residents.
The dinner will be held 1-4 p.m. Thanksgiving Day, Thursday, Nov. 22 at the Brigantine Beach Community Center, 265 42nd St. Take-out will be available.
Though the dinner is complimentary, donations to the True Spirit Coalition are requested. The money will be used to assist families affected by Hurricane Sandy.
Food for the dinner is a donation by Jill Parker and family, as well as Goodfellows Restaurant in Absecon. Students from Atlantic County Institute of Technology will cook the turkeys. The menu is being developed by Adrienne Sharp.
Reservations are required by 4 p.m. Tuesday, Nov. 20 so volunteers will know how much food to prepare. Call (609) 289-9134.
Those who require transportation should call the BBCC at (609) 264-7350 by Tuesday, Nov. 20. The Senior Shuttle will be available 1-5 p.m.
